Influence Of O-Phenylenediamine On The Catalysis At Hrp Enzyme Electrode In L,4-Dioxane, Hong Chen, Hui-Huang Wu

Journal of Electrochemistry

Horseradish peroxidase(HRP)was immobilized by crosslinkage on the glassycarbon electrode to prepare the enzyme electrede ,where the reduction of H_2O_2 was studied in l,4-dioxane media. It was shown that HRP electrode can catalyze the reduction of H_2O_2 without anymedintor,however, as an activator,o-phenylenediamine can promote the bio-catalysis. In thepresence of the activator,the parallel reactions occurred on the enzyme electrode. The workingcondition of the HRP electrede was investigated as the sensors for H_2O_2 and o-phenylenediamine,alsothe influence of water content in organic phase was discussed on the performance of the enzymeelectrode in organic phase.
